Frequently Asked Questions

How do Southern Careers Institute-Austin and Thomas More University compare?
Southern Careers Institute-Austin (Austin, TX) has no published acceptance rate, in-state tuition of -, and median 10-year earnings of $27,035. Thomas More University (Crestview Hills, KY) has an acceptance rate of 90.3%, in-state tuition of $39,800, and median 10-year earnings of $59,384.
Which school has higher graduate earnings, Southern Careers Institute-Austin or Thomas More University?
Thomas More University graduates earn more at 10 years out, with a median of $59,384 vs $27,035. Source: U.S. Department of Education College Scorecard.
Which school is more affordable, Southern Careers Institute-Austin or Thomas More University?
Based on average net price (after grants and scholarships), Thomas More University is the more affordable option at $21,835 per year versus $25,660.
